Secure Interview Room — Contractor Notice, Varnholt Annex

Room 2B is for candidate interviews only. No tools, no unescorted entry, no photography. Contractors working nearby must check the booking sheet before starting noisy work. If access is required for maintenance, obtain sign-off from the facilities desk first and log your time in and out. Leave the room as found: blinds down, recorder off, chairs squared. The door locks automatically; re-entry requires the code below.

staff pass of kawip-hawef = bdg-QLP-2

Subject: On-call handover — thumbnail queue

Handing off Pixelforge on-call. The thumbnail generation queue backed up twice this week; root cause was oversized TIFF uploads choking the resize workers. I added a size guard in the consumer — see the open PR, it needs review before the weekend. Redrive script is in the runbook. Watch queue depth after 02:00 UTC. If it pages again and you're stuck, escalate to the media platform team at the address below.

escalation mailbox, yajeg-bageg: quenax.olidor@lumiccorp.internal

# Font vendoring for the Bramblewick UI.
#
# We vendor all third-party fonts into the build rather than
# fetching at runtime — the Osterly CDN mirror is unreliable and
# licensing requires pinned versions anyway. Subset aggressively;
# full families blow the bundle budget. If you add a face, update
# the manifest hash too. Subsetting and cache knobs are defined below.

tuning constants:
QUOTAS = {
    "druwyn": 5,
    "holix": 5,
    "zorath": 5,
    "holwyn": 10,
}

- [ ] **Autocomplete index check (Swiftsearch).** Yes, this belongs in the key ceremony — the slow autocomplete index on the Penhallow cluster shares its unseal credential with the signing vault, so we verify it here. Ping the suggest endpoint; anything over 800ms means the index is cold and needs a warm-up pass before you proceed. If the warm-up job asks for authorization (it will, first run after a reseal), give it the recovery passphrase noted below.

vault phrase of tajef-tafog = istox-sorax-zorox-casok-holox-kelix-weneth-drueth-casion